13. Which one among the following was NOT a Panch Sheel principle?

Correct Answer: (c) Nuclear deterrence
Solution:

Panchsheel, or the Five Principles of Peaceful Coexistence, were first formally enunciated in the Agreement on Trade and Intercourse between the Tibet region of China and India signed on April 29, 1954, which stated, in its preamble, that the two Governments "have resolved to enter into the present Agreement based on the following five principles:-

i Mutual respect for each other's territorial integrity and sovereignty,
ii. Mutual non-aggression,
iii. Mutual non-interference,
iv. Equality and mutual benefit, and
v. Peaceful co-existence.
Hence Nuclear deterrence is not among five principles of Panch sheel.

14. Who among the following had organised, in 1904, a secret society of revolutionaries named Abhinav Bharat?

Correct Answer: (d) VD Savarkar
Solution:

Abhinav Bharat Society was a secret society founded by Vinayak Damodar Savarkar and his brother Ganesh Damodar Savarkar in 1904. The original organization believed in armed revolution, and was responsible for the assassinations of some officers of the ruling British government before being disbanded in 1952.

15. The principle that the framing ofthe new Constitution for independent India should be primarily (though not solely) the responsibility of Indians themselves, was for the first time conceded in the

Correct Answer: (b) August Offer of Viceroy Linlithgow
Solution:

The Viceroy Linlithgow made a set of proposals called the 'August offer'. For the first time, the right of Indians to frame their own constitution was acknowledged.

As per the terms of the August Offer, a representative Indian body would be framed after the war to frame a constitution for India. Dominion status was the objective for India.

17. Which one of the foliowing mountains lies in between Caspian Sea and Black Sea?

Correct Answer: (a) Caucasus
Solution:

The mountain range that lies between the Black and Caspian Seas is called the Caucasus Mountain Range, or just the Caucasus Mountains. The great historic barrier of the Caucasus Mountains rises up across the wide isthmus separating the Black and Caspian seas in the region where Europe and Asia converge.

Trendinggenerally from northwest to southeast, the mountains consist of two ranges-the Greater Caucasus (Russian: Bolshoy Kavkaz) in the north and the Lesser Caucasus(Maly Kavkaz) in the south. Mount Elbrus in the Greater Caucasus range, at 18,510 feet (5,642 metres), is the highest peak.

18. Bagalihar, Dulhasti and Salal hydro power projects have been developed on which of the following rivers?

Correct Answer: (d) Chenab only
Solution:

Bagalihar, Dulhasti and Salal hydro power projects thave been developed on Chenab river. Baglihar Dam is built on Chenab River in the Doda district of Jammu & Kashmir. Dulhasti hydro power is located in Kishtwar district where as Salal power station is located in Reasi district of Union Territory of Jammu & Kashmir.
